    Abstract: An amorphous silica suitable for use in a dental composition has a weight mean particle size in the range 3 to 15 ?m with at least 90 per cent by weight of particles having a size below 20 ?m, a Radioactive Dentine Abrasion (RDA) determined on an aqueous slurry of the silica powder of 100 to 220, a Pellicle Cleaning Ratio (PCR), when incorporated in a dental composition at 10 per cent by weight, greater than 85, the ratio of PCR to RDA being in the range 0.4:1 to less than 1:1 and having a Plastics Abrasion Value (PAV) in the range 11 to 19. A silica having the above properties is prepared by a precipitation route. The silica made available by the invention is also useful as an anti-blocking agent in plastics.
